Ukraine works on joint production with Europe of all necessary air defense systems, missiles and all types of drones - Zelenskyy
Air defense cooperation is currently Ukraine’s biggest diplomatic priority, President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elenskyy said.
"Russia is not changing its tactics of combined strikes, and the defense forces must be ready to shoot down all types of aerial targets," Zelenskyy wrote on Telegram.
According to him, that is why the PURL program, which enables the acquisition of necessary anti-ballistic missiles, must continue to operate.
"The Ukrainian side is currently working to jointly produce with European partners all necessary air defence systems, missiles for them and each type of drone, without which real defence in modern warfare is impossible," Zelenskyy said.
He also explained that as a result of this week’s work, Ukraine will be provided with additional strengthening capabilities through joint work with Europeans on drones and joint production.
"For every Russian strike there will be our responses - our long-range sanctions against the aggressor, our internal development of the defence system and our cooperation with partners who genuinely value human life," Zelenskyy said.
